Casa Havana serves fast, filling Cuban fare in Chelsea--for less than the price of a hardcover cookbook.

by Justin Hartung

In Short
When Havana Chelsea closed shop, the neighborhood lost one of its few cheap eats staples. But another Cuban spot has risen in its place, and though the owners are different, much remains the same. Brightly colored murals make for a festive, if low-key, ambience, and antique bistro lamps hang above the few counter seats. Classic sandwiches like the Cubano get a kicky twist with chorizo, and other lunch-friendly options include tamales and ham croquettes. Plates of roast pork, fried chicken and whole red snapper offer belly-filling dinner options for less than $15.
